Designer Tips for Best Results

  1. Test on Scrap Fabric First: Especially if you’re planning to scale down or apply it to a new type of fabric.
  2. Check Thread Color Contrast: Ensure the red, white, and blue stand out clearly on your chosen background. Sometimes swapping out colors can improve visibility.
  3. Review Stitch Density: Dense fills can cause puckering on certain materials. Adjust as needed for each fabric type.
  4. Confirm Hoop Size: Larger versions will require bigger hoops. Don’t assume it fits unless specified in the file metadata.
  5. Inspect Small Details: The bear’s facial features and flag patterns may need extra attention when scaling or adjusting for different machines.
  6. Use Proper Stabilizer: Especially important for stretchy or lightweight fabrics. A tear-away or cut-away stabilizer can make a big difference.
  7. Consider Black and White Mockups: Before finalizing colors, try a grayscale version to assess how the design reads visually without color bias.
  8. Compare Light and Dark Backgrounds: See how the design interacts with both to determine where it performs best.
  9. Check Licensing Before Selling: If you're an Etsy seller or digital product creator, confirm whether the design allows for resale or commercial reproduction.
